#EmCee2020: FLT. LT. DR. MRS. Cynthia and her bridesmaids came through in their military uniforms

Whoever said you cannot be a traditional Ghanaian bride and flex all your military accolades side by side probably has not met FLT. LT. DR. MRS. Cynthia of the Ghana Armed Forces.

The military bride and her girls have gone viral after opting for full military regalia for her second look along with her bridesmaids.

Bridal Makeup Artist, Marron Faces who first shared the trending video on her Instagram account, wrote: “FLT. LT. DR. MRS. and her bridesmaids!! How unique is this?”

Which led others to compliment the bold move and called for more of such looks because most women in the security services tend to avoid wearing their uniforms on their big day as opposed to the majority of men who do.
